Celeste Insell has worked on both stage and screen. She studied in New York City at the Herbert Berghof studio in the early 1980's. She made her television debut playing the principal role of Nurse Graham in the made for TV movie "A Piano for Mrs. Camino" which starred Bette Davis; and playing opposite Miss Davis remains one of the highlights of her career. She also played the role of "Lady in Blue" and later went on to play the very demanding lead role of "Lady in Red" in the Western Canadian touring production of "For Colored Girls..." The production ran for six months in Vancouver after receiving rave reviews. She enjoys performing both in comedy and drama; and is always up for a challenge. Some of her more recent roles include a Lifetime made for TV movie "Grim Sleeper" (2014) and a Canadian indie short film "Mattress" (2014) directed by Michelle Kee which was selected for entry in the Cannes short film category. Ms. Insell is also a published writer. Show less «
